[慢性疲劳:有什么研究? 而是为了什么?]
概括
慢性疲劳是一种常见的,致残的疾病. 诊断需要仔细的临床评估,因为慢性疲劳综合征缺乏特定的生物标志物,运动测试指导个性化治疗.
科学领域:
- 内部医学 内部医学
- 临床诊断 临床诊断 临床诊断
- 运动生理学 运动生理学
背景情况:
- 慢性疲劳是一种普遍和残疾的投诉,在医疗保健层面遇到.
- 内科医生经常面临的挑战是诊断持续疲劳的根本原因.
- 目前的理解表明慢性疲劳是多因素的,涉及生物,心理和社会因素.
研究的目的:
- 概述了无法解释的慢性疲劳的诊断方法.
- 强调临床评估和运动测试在疲劳管理中的作用.
- 澄清当前对慢性疲劳综合征 (CFS) 的理解,以及其与异常疲劳的区别.
主要方法:
- 临床检查和病史记录是主要的诊断工具.
- 使用简单的评分尺度有助于疲劳的病因和差异诊断.
- 代谢和心肺呼吸系统运动测试对于评估和管理至关重要.
主要成果:
- 无法解释的疲劳需要进行彻底的临床评估,并有限地依赖于基本生物学之外的广泛的补充测试.
- 慢性疲劳综合征 (CFS) 缺乏特定的生物标志物,并且与异常慢性疲劳没有明确区别.
- 疲劳通常源于复杂的,相互作用的病因因素 (倾向性,沉性,延续性).
结论:
- 慢性疲劳的综合诊断策略优先考虑临床评估和有针对性的调查.
- 代谢和心肺呼吸系统运动测试对于个性化管理策略至关重要.
- 适应性体力活动 (APA) 和再培训是慢性疲劳的推治疗方法.

Myasthenia gravis is an autoimmune condition affecting neuromuscular transmission, causing generalized weakness in skeletal muscles. Initial diagnoses rely on patients' signs, symptoms, and medical history. The challenge lies in distinguishing myasthenia from other muscular dystrophies. An important diagnostic feature is the significant improvement of symptoms after administering anticholinesterase inhibitors.
